Transaction ad81f6e23dd7e95ecb9bfa415dbfd314335a64f7a7baf058057db633d60f4886
1 Input
1 Output
-
ad81f6e23dd7e95ecb9bfa415dbfd314335a64f7a7baf058057db633d60f4886:0
- value
- 191078603
- script pubkey
- OP_0 OP_PUSHBYTES_20 826f5db980c1956e0f33f2ab5237b1a60357432f
- address
- bc1qsfh4mwvqcx2kuren7244yda35cp4wse07eytdz